Jets hire Dunbar as DL coach, promote Sutton

FLORHAM PARK, N.J. (AP) — The New York Jets have hired Karl Dunbar as their defensive line coach after he served in the same position for the Minnesota Vikings the last six seasons.

The team has also announced Monday that Bob Sutton has been promoted to assistant head coach/linebackers coach, Lance Taylor has been bumped up to assistant tight ends coach/quality control, and Matt Cavanaugh will return as the Jets’ quarterbacks coach.

New York has also brought back Mike Smith as outside linebackers coach, a few weeks after he left the Jets to become the co-defensive coordinator at West Virginia. The Jets also hired Justus Galac and Paul Ricci as assistant strength and conditioning coaches.

Dunbar, a former NFL defensive lineman, helped turn the Vikings’ defensive front into one of the best in football.
